Should you play it?

Your time machine is broken. And it looks like you are stuck in the past. Try to create your own civilization and return home!

What works
  • Relaxing and meditative gameplay
  • Simple and accessible colony management
  • Steady technological progression
  • Frequent developer updates
  • Charming pixel art style
Things to keep in mind
  • Lack of challenge and threats
  • Limited automation and tedious micromanagement
  • Small map and limited exploration
  • No tutorial or guidance for new players
  • Ai and task management need improvement
